  • How To Build Wealth By Investing To Unlock Financial Freedom As An Entrepreneur With Hannah Mayfield
    2025/12/07

    Scared of investing, but know it could be the key to you unlocking your own personal version of wealth and financial freedom? This episode of The Remote CEO Life Podcast will help you debunk and change your mindset on investing and identify if building wealth and financial freedom through an investment portfolio could be something for you.

    To walk us through this hot topic, I’m joined by Hannah Mayfield - a qualified financial adviser and founder of What Is Wealth - to talk all things investing, financial freedom and building wealth, specifically when you’re self-employed.

    Hannah shares her personal journey into finance, breaks down common money mindset blocks, and reveals practical steps for how to start investing - even if you're new, overwhelmed or afraid of taking risks.

    Please note: This episode is for inspirational purposes only and does not constitute financial advice. Always consult a qualified financial adviser before making any investment decisions.

    What we cover in this episode:

    - What true wealth really means (and why it’s more than just money)
    - Why investing is the ultimate cheat code to freedom
    - The mindset shift to help you stop seeing money as a risk
    - How compound interest can change your future (even with small amounts)
    - Simple ways to get started if you’re new to investing
    - Why building wealth is an emotional and practical journey
    - How your business income can support long-term freedom through smart investing

  • What Happens When Your Business Fails - And How to Start Over at 40 With a Social Media Agency
    2025/10/26

    What really happens when your business fails? And how do you start again at the age of 40?

    In this episode of The Remote CEO Life Podcast, I’m chatting to social media agency owner and podcast host Jen Kinal.

    After running a successful event planning business for over a decade, Jen lost everything during the pandemic and was forced to start over - at 40.

    She shares the raw truth behind burnout, rebuilding her confidence, and starting a brand new business that finally gave her the freedom she wanted.

    You’ll hear:

    - What it really feels like when your business fails
    - How Jen went from events to launching her own social media agency
    - The steps she took to recover from burnout and rebuild her confidence
    - Why undercharging can keep you stuck (and how to fix it)
    - The systems and mindset shifts she put in place to avoid burnout for good
    - How to create recurring revenue in a service-based business
    - What freedom looks like when you design your business your way
